Colombian football is once again the focus of attention for major European clubs. Besides Luis Díaz, the right-back of the Colombian National Team, Daniel Muñoz, is on the list of potential targets for Real Madrid in the medium and long term. The white club is reportedly looking for a full-back with a more modern and powerful profile.
Diario AS highlights that Muñoz, currently at Crystal Palace, is one of the ten players being watched from Valdebebas. He is the only one on the list over 28 years old and is fully established in the Premier League. The possible arrival of the Colombian would occur despite the recent signing of Trent Alexander-Arnold and the recovery of Dani Carvajal.
Daniel Muñoz himself has openly expressed his ambition to play in the European elite. "If you ask me, it would be a dream for me to play in one of these clubs, be it Barcelona, PSG, Real Madrid, Manchester United," commented the full-back.
The Colombian emphasized that he works day by day to "catch the attention of one of these clubs." However, he clarified that his current focus is on Crystal Palace, where he has become a standard-bearer and with which he has won the two official titles in its history.
The full-back, known for his power and runs down the right flank, is the profile that, according to AS, coach Xabi Alonso needs at the Santiago Bernabéu.
Muñoz reiterated his commitment to his current club and the National Team: "Now I focus on my club, on doing things well at Crystal Palace. The focus is on Crystal Palace, we'll see when the winter market approaches."
